Albert Edward Birch c. 1893 - 1915

Albert Edward Birch of Australia was born circa 1893. He was married to Hilda Emily Bourne in 1915, and died at age 21 years old on March 14, 1915. Albert Birch was buried at Estaires Communal Cemetery And Extension Ii. L. 4. in France.
